YP Letters: Council funds should not go to Ryedale fracking fight

From: David Pasley, Mill Lane, Pickering.

I AM very shocked to find that the newly-appointed Mayor of Malton, Coun Paul Andrews, and also Coun Ed Jowitt, are asking that Ryedale Council finance be used to campaign against North Yorkshire County Council.

I refer to the proposal that Ryedale District Council donates £20,000 to help to pay for a judicial review against North Yorkshire County Council’s recent decision to approve a planning application to frack at Kirby Misperton.

I find the idea appalling as it is likely to get the support of fellow councillors who are opponents of fracking and actively campaign against it. Is it sensible that Ryedale District Council should be fighting our county council in the courts? The prolonged saga concerning Wentworth Street car park comes to mind.
